Senior Software Engineer I - Data Platform
Careem
Date: 3 weeks ago
City: Lahore
Contract type: Full time
About the Company
Careem is building the Everything App for the greater Middle East — making it easy to move around, order food and groceries, manage payments, and more. Our purpose is simple: to simplify and improve people’s lives and build an awesome organisation that inspires.
Since 2012, Careem has enabled earnings for over 2.5 million Captains, simplified the lives of more than 70 million customers, and built a platform where the region’s best talent and entrepreneurs thrive. We operate in 70+ cities across 10 countries, from Morocco to Pakistan.
We’re now entering our next chapter — one powered by AI. We’re looking for AI talent: curious problem-solvers who know how to apply AI to build tools, automate workflows, and create real impact. Whether it’s streamlining operations, enhancing customer experience, or reimagining internal systems — we want people who can make Careem work smarter and move faster.
About The Team
The Careem Data Platform team’s mission is to provide a platform to abstract big data complexities and enable fast, reliable and secure access to data. As a member of this team, you will be at the forefront of fulfilling this mission. You will be working with the top talent of the region, leveraging modern big data tools and techniques to solve the region’s day to day problems, on top of our own in-house data platform, serving users in real-time.
This role will be part of the Data processing and computation platform team. We are heavily invested in open source technologies like Apache Spark, Apache Kafka, Apache Trino etc. You would also have an opportunity to contribute and collaborate with the open source community.
What You'll Do
Careem is building the Everything App for the greater Middle East — making it easy to move around, order food and groceries, manage payments, and more. Our purpose is simple: to simplify and improve people’s lives and build an awesome organisation that inspires.
Since 2012, Careem has enabled earnings for over 2.5 million Captains, simplified the lives of more than 70 million customers, and built a platform where the region’s best talent and entrepreneurs thrive. We operate in 70+ cities across 10 countries, from Morocco to Pakistan.
We’re now entering our next chapter — one powered by AI. We’re looking for AI talent: curious problem-solvers who know how to apply AI to build tools, automate workflows, and create real impact. Whether it’s streamlining operations, enhancing customer experience, or reimagining internal systems — we want people who can make Careem work smarter and move faster.
About The Team
The Careem Data Platform team’s mission is to provide a platform to abstract big data complexities and enable fast, reliable and secure access to data. As a member of this team, you will be at the forefront of fulfilling this mission. You will be working with the top talent of the region, leveraging modern big data tools and techniques to solve the region’s day to day problems, on top of our own in-house data platform, serving users in real-time.
This role will be part of the Data processing and computation platform team. We are heavily invested in open source technologies like Apache Spark, Apache Kafka, Apache Trino etc. You would also have an opportunity to contribute and collaborate with the open source community.
What You'll Do
- Bringing an innovative and creative mindset to data engineering challenges to develop a modern data platform with efficient reusable components
- Design, architect, solutioning, implement and test rapid prototypes that demonstrate value of the data and present them to diverse audiences
- Your focus will be on making code more efficient to run, optimizing resources across the cluster, and speeding up the compute workloads we face
- Continuously improve our engineering processes, tests, and systems that allow us to scale the code base and productivity of the team
- Collaborate with teams globally and operate in a fast paced environment
- Responsible for creating reusable and scalable data pipelines
- 5+ years of hands-on experience in software development
- Bachelor's degree in Computer Science or a related technical field
- Strong expertise in Scala, Java, Python or similar programming languages
- Proven track record of building distributed systems or working on comparable large-scale projects
- Deep understanding of cloud-native Big Data technologies
- Solid foundation in software engineering principles and design best practices
- Passion for developing high-quality, maintainable, and performant software within a collaborative, high-performing global team
- Experience with cloud control planes (AWS, GCP, etc.) or database internals, including query optimization
- Contributions to open-source projects will be preferred
- Experience with Docker and Kubernetes is a plus
How to apply
To apply for this job you need to authorize on our website. If you don't have an account yet, please register.
Post a resumeSimilar jobs
Trainee Business Developer
TechSwivel LLC,
Lahore
2 hours ago
Unpaid Trainee For 3 MonthsJob Timings: 2:00 PM - 11:00 PMWorking Days: Monday - FridayJob Type: Full-time (Remote Opportunity)Skills & Requirements:Bachelor's in Computer Science, Information Technology, or any Relevant Field.Good command of English communication.Fresh graduates or graduates having up to 06 Months of experience.Ability to work in a fast-paced team environment.Online Bidding on certain Freelancing Platforms.Emailing to Direct Clients.Proposal Writing.Excellent...
Executive Assistant
Jaspi,
Lahore
2 days ago
We are seeking a Executive Assistant who goes beyond typical administrative duties. This role involves conducting research and development as well as learning to automate small workflows, such as sending emails to every new user who signs up for our product. The ideal candidate is highly resourceful, adept at figuring out new tasks using simple tools and AI assistance.Key ResponsibilitiesResearch...
Senior Manager, Data & Digitalisation
Better Cotton Initiative,
Lahore
6 days ago
Starting Date: ASAPContract type: Full-time and open-endedSalary: if hired in Delhi – INR 4,150,513/Year, if in Lahore– PKR 10,597,002.75/Year, commensurate with relevant experience and skillsLocation: Delhi, LahoreApplication closing date: 9th December 2025About The JobAre you purpose-led and ready to shape the digital future of sustainable cotton? Join Better Cotton as Senior Manager, Data and Digitalisation and lead our transformation towards...